McIntosh

981 Old Augusta Road, Rincon, GA 31326

Plant Summary Information

McIntosh is ranked #37 out of 46 natural gas power plants in Georgia in terms of total annual net electricity generation.

McIntosh is comprised of 8 generators and generated 7.0 GWh during the 3-month period between November 2023 to February 2024.
